Pakistan - 13,466 incidences

In Pakistan, the surname 'Inam' is quite common, with 13,466 recorded incidences. It has historical significance and is believed to have originated from the Arabic word 'Inaam,' meaning gift or reward. The 'Inam' surname is often associated with nobility and honor in Pakistani culture, reflecting traits of generosity and kindness.
